构建基于数据中台的云南智慧旅游系统
2025-07-13 18:39

随着大数据时代的到来,数据中台作为一种新型的企业级架构,正在被越来越多的企业采用。在旅游行业中,数据中台可以有效整合各类数据资源,提升运营效率和服务质量。本文将以云南省为例,探讨如何通过构建数据中台来推动智慧旅游的发展。
数据中台的核心在于数据集成与共享。以下是使用Python实现数据采集与清洗的一个示例:
import pandas as pd
def load_data(file_path):
"""加载CSV文件中的原始数据"""
data = pd.read_csv(file_path)
return data
def clean_data(data):
"""对数据进行清洗,去除缺失值"""
cleaned_data = data.dropna()
return cleaned_data
if __name__ == "__main__":
file_path = "tourism_data.csv"
raw_data = load_data(file_path)
processed_data = clean_data(raw_data)
print(processed_data.head())

在数据处理完成后,我们需要对数据进行分析,以发现潜在的旅游趋势和需求。下面是一个简单的数据分析脚本:
import matplotlib.pyplot as plt
def analyze_visits_by_month(data):
"""按月份统计访问次数"""
monthly_visits = data['visit_date'].value_counts().sort_index()
monthly_visits.plot(kind='bar')
plt.title('Monthly Visits Analysis')
plt.xlabel('Month')
plt.ylabel('Number of Visits')
plt.show()
if __name__ == "__main__":
analyze_visits_by_month(processed_data)
通过上述方法,我们可以高效地整合和分析云南地区的旅游数据,从而为游客提供更加个性化和智能化的服务体验。未来,随着更多功能模块的加入,数据中台将在智慧旅游领域发挥更大的作用。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:数据中台

